Just made it back from the very successful DrupalCamp Australia 2008 in Sydney on Saturday. Great venue, good variety of speakers, interesting topics and a great change to meet names from the Australian Drupal community in person.
Highlights for me were:
- Introduction to Simpletest by Simon Roberts - this module makes it so easy to start creating automated tests and will improve development speed.
- Domain access module, an alternate and mighty fine sounding way of implementing multiple sites.
- Exciting new announcements by Gordon Heydon about version 4 of the e-Commerce module - smaller, tighter, more flexible, supporting only Drupal 6 and scheduled to be released early next year.
Many thanks to Ryan Cross for organising the event and Jim Woulfe & Uni Sydney for organising and providing the venue!
